1 definition by LalaMusicBaby

Amzaning gifted at music! This girl can sing her heart out! Shes super pretty and has long brown hair. She's a major fashionista! Every one loves to be around her.
Wow, That girl is such a Tiera!

pretty nice Crazy Talented Lovable
by LalaMusicBaby May 24, 2011
Get the Tiera mug.